The Role of Artificial Intelligence in Modern Marketing

Artificial Intelligence (AI) has moved from being a futuristic concept to a practical, everyday tool that is transforming how modern marketing works. Today, businesses of all sizes use AI to understand customer behavior, personalize communication, automate tasks, and make smarter decisions faster. As digital competition grows, AI is no longer a luxury in marketing — it is becoming a necessity.

Modern marketing is driven by data, and AI is the engine that turns that data into actionable insights. From predicting customer preferences to optimizing ad campaigns in real time, AI helps marketers move from guesswork to precision. The result is more efficient strategies, better customer experiences, and stronger business growth.

Smarter Customer Insights Through Data Analysis

One of the biggest advantages of AI in marketing is its ability to analyze massive amounts of data quickly and accurately. Every online interaction — clicks, searches, purchases, time spent on pages — creates data. AI systems can process this information at a scale humans simply cannot match.

By studying patterns in customer behavior, AI helps marketers understand what audiences want, when they want it, and how they prefer to receive it. This allows businesses to create targeted campaigns instead of generic messages. Rather than marketing to everyone, brands can market to the right people with the right message at the right time.

AI-powered analytics tools also help predict future behavior. Marketers can forecast trends, estimate customer lifetime value, and identify which leads are most likely to convert. This predictive power makes planning more strategic and reduces wasted marketing spend.

Personalization at Scale

Personalization has become one of the most important elements of successful marketing. Customers expect brands to understand their needs and deliver relevant content. AI makes personalization possible at scale.

Streaming platforms, e-commerce stores, and social media networks use AI recommendation systems to suggest products and content based on user behavior. Email marketing tools powered by AI can customize subject lines, send times, and content for each subscriber. Websites can dynamically change what they display depending on who is visiting.

This level of personalization improves engagement and builds stronger customer relationships. When users see content that matches their interests, they are more likely to interact and convert. AI enables marketers to deliver these tailored experiences automatically and continuously.

Automation and Efficiency

Marketing involves many repetitive and time-consuming tasks — scheduling posts, sending emails, segmenting audiences, managing bids, and generating reports. AI helps automate these processes, freeing marketers to focus on strategy and creativity.

AI-driven marketing automation platforms can run campaigns across multiple channels with minimal manual input. Chatbots handle customer inquiries 24/7, improving response time and reducing support workload. AI tools can also automatically test variations of ads and landing pages, then shift budget toward the best performers.

This automation does not replace marketers — it enhances their productivity. Teams can achieve more with fewer resources while maintaining consistent quality and speed.

AI in Content Creation and Optimization

Content remains central to modern marketing, and AI is increasingly involved in both creating and optimizing it. AI tools can generate blog drafts, social media captions, ad copy, product descriptions, and even video scripts. While human oversight is still essential, AI speeds up the first stage of content production.

Beyond creation, AI also improves content performance. It can analyze which headlines attract more clicks, which keywords improve search rankings, and which formats drive engagement. SEO tools powered by AI recommend structure, readability improvements, and keyword opportunities.

Marketers can use these insights to refine their content strategy continuously instead of relying only on periodic reviews.

Better Advertising Performance

Digital advertising has become more complex, with multiple platforms, formats, and bidding systems. AI plays a major role in optimizing ad performance in real time.

AI algorithms adjust bids automatically based on audience behavior, device type, time of day, and conversion probability. They test multiple ad variations and quickly identify which combinations deliver the best results. This process, known as dynamic optimization, improves return on ad spend.

Programmatic advertising — where ads are bought and placed automatically — also relies heavily on AI. It ensures ads reach the most relevant audiences at the lowest effective cost. This makes campaigns more efficient and measurable.

Improved Customer Experience

Customer experience is now a key differentiator for brands. AI helps create smoother, faster, and more helpful customer journeys.

AI chatbots and virtual assistants provide instant support, answer common questions, and guide users through purchases. Voice search optimization helps brands stay visible as more users rely on voice assistants. AI-driven sentiment analysis monitors social media and reviews to understand how customers feel about a brand in real time.

These tools allow companies to respond quickly, solve problems earlier, and maintain a positive brand image.

Challenges and Ethical Considerations

Despite its benefits, AI in marketing also brings challenges. Data privacy is a major concern. Marketers must use customer data responsibly and comply with privacy regulations. Transparency about how data is collected and used builds trust.

There is also the risk of over-automation. Marketing still requires human creativity, emotional intelligence, and ethical judgment. AI should support human marketers, not completely replace human decision-making.

Bias in AI models is another issue. If training data is biased, AI outputs can also be biased. Regular review and responsible model design are necessary to ensure fairness.
